Germaine Louise Compton

April 13, 1929 — February 25, 2018

Germaine Louise (Boulanger) Compton, 88, Green Bay, died peacefully in her home on February 25, 2018, with family by her side, joining her husband of 70 years, Harold, who passed away only 35 days prior. Germaine was born on April 13, 1929, to the late Mary and Leo Boulanger. She graduated from Green Bay East High School in 1947. Shortly after she married the “man of her dreams,” as our dad would say. Devoted to each other, they shared a happy and loving home raising four children together.

Germaine was very proud of her family, who she loved very much. She enjoyed having family together, especially at their cabin on Roberts Lake, where she always had a refrigerator full and a warm meal cooking. As grandchildren and great grandchildren came along, they both sat back and enjoyed watching the kids grow up and entertain them.

Germaine was the most loving mother that anyone could ask for. She was a sweet, mild-mannered and gentle woman. But as our hearts are breaking here on earth, we know she is back in our dad’s arms in heaven, with her son by her side, whom she lost 26 years ago.
